4.5 stars (rounded up to 5). This place offers something unique in my opinion and it's curry ramen. I think the closest description I would say is soup curry found in Hokkaido + ramen. For those who don't speak much Japanese (like me), when you order I think they ask you what kind of noodles you would like, thick or thin. Then they ask if you want rice if you get the special combo (1000yen). I asked for a regular size. The soup comes bubbling hot but the noodles quickly cools it down + a wonton (it was quite good). I actually ran out of the soup with about 20% noodles and rice left and noticed another customer asking for more "soup" (they add hot water). This soup is suppose to be like "sobaya" in which you finish up the broth. But, I opted to use it to finish all I had left. Which is why I gave it 4.5. I think they need to serve a little more soup. The chashu was great. The finishing touch with with grill marks shines through (albeit they only do it to one side... another reason why I dinged the points). Flavors are great no doubt👍- not spicy at all imo. Watch out for splash!

Do you like both curry and ramen equally? Here you can have both! This place is tucked away one floor up from the street and they serve heavenly curry ramen! It’s a solid and tasty meal. The curry broth is quite rich and taste intensely of the spice, the noodles have a good texture (choose the thin ones), the pork is tender and juicy, the other condiments are cooked spinach, thinly sliced leek, nori and a small homemade dumpling (delicious). In the room to the window side they have a bookshelf with manga and they play japanese retro 90’s music. The atmosphere is friendly and the staff are kind and service minded. This is one of my favourite ramen places in Tokyo!

I could give 5 stars for this shop! This is a very unique curry ramen which doesn't make you feel bad as you eat too much curry. I ordered ramen with wonton and large size. Trust me, you should get large size. When giving the tickets, they will ask whether you want thick or thin ramens. Even though there are no English menus, the staff is trying to ask you in English if you don't speak Japanese. The ambience and warm welcome from the staff and amazing curry soup truly give a memorable experience in my heart. Definitely will come back and try other menus
